    clive0510 said:
    My neighbour has just had his credit card statement, and there is showing on there a payment going out under paypal. well, that's not possible as he's not signed up to paypal, and doesn't even own a computer. so told him to phone the c/c company straight away, and if it can't be sorted I will email them on his behalf so they have it in black n white. 
    as the title says, you must check your statements.
    For a start they will not deal with you as you are not the customer & I guess do not hold any sort of mandate to act on their behalf. So pointless waste of time.
    Then there is the issue that even if they email, there is no way to verify a customer.
    Best way is for them to ring, then ask if you can speak on their behalf.
